First on my list would have to be seagulls. There are some 50 separate species of seagulls throughout the world, from the great black-backed with its five-foot wingspan and weighing in at around 5 pounds to the little gull, which weighs in at around 4 ounces. Throughout North America, there are some 28 recognized varieties, many of which can be found residing along our eastern seaboard. Some of the more common to be found would be the American herring gull, with pale grey backs, pinkish legs and yellow beaks with a red spot; the ring billed gull sporting that distinct black ring around their yellow bill, and yellow legs; and THE most recognized, the laughing gull, with a solid black hood (which fades to grey in winter) and it’s all so familiar high pitched “laughing” screech which to me, it the definitive sound of the shore.

I’m also fascinated by a particular behavior they have, and that’s when they come across an intact clam, pick it up in their beak, take off and then drop it on concrete, asphalt, or a sturdy wooden dock to smash it and get to the clam’s insides. Amazing learned behavior.

Next on my list would be ducks. Around the world, there are around 130-160 species, with around 30-40 species here in the U.S., broken down into two primary groups: Dabbling ducks (a.k.a. “Puddle ducks”) that feed by tipping forward in shallow water to graze on water plants, and diving ducks that will go completely submerged in deeper water for aquatic plants and the occasional small minnow.
Amongst dabbling ducks are the blue-winged teal, wood ducks, northern pintails, and mallards. Common diving ducks include buffleheads, redheads, canvasbacks, and scaups.

Although not seen very often in the northeastern U.S., pelicans are a fixture of the coast in the southeast. They range the world over on every continent, save Antarctica, but there are only eight separate species. And those eight are divided into two groups: tree nesters and ground nesters. Unlike most other bird species, pelicans live relatively long lives – 10-25 years – yet in captivity have been known to live twice that long.
For as ungainly as they are when waddling about land, when in flight, pelicans are the most graceful gliders in the world, usually flying so close to the surface that their wing tips dip in the water.
Pelicans also hold the distinction of suffering from a massive misconception about their life cycle or, more specifically, how they die, a miss truth even I once fell prey to. You’ll hear it said that most pelicans die as a result of going blind from their constant dives from above for fish, or when older, they break their necks from that same continuous splash diving. Wrong.
According to the Cornell Lab of Ornithology, “Pelicans have several adaptations to diving, including air sacs beneath the skin on their breasts that serve as cushions and floats. While diving, they also rotate their bodies to the left, probably to avoid injury to their trachea and esophagus, which are on the right side of the neck. They further explain that most reports of blindness in pelicans are “for other reasons, including infections resulting from disease.” Discarded hooks and lines are also common culprits for pelican mortality.
And now we come to those deliberate, slow strutting, then lightning-fast shallow water strikers, herons and egrets, another family of relatively common coastal birds. Truth be told, there isn’t a whole lot of biological difference between the two other than size and coloring (of both plumage and legs). They are both long legged, long necked and eat fish… with the exception of the cattle egret, which lives inland and, as its name would suggest, feeds in fields, following cows and horses around for the insects they stir up with their hooves.
All herons and egrets share one significant and unique trait, which is the ability to transform themselves from a statuesque, upright, long-necked creature into a compact package by tucking (folding, really) their uniquely S-shaped necks, which have twice the number of vertebrae we humans have (21-25 versus 10). When tucked in, these bones stack and coil upon each other and it’s this construction that gives them the ability to uncoil this “spring,” thrusting its neck and dagger-like bill forward with considerable power and precision. And then, seemingly against all odds, they slap around and tenderize that fish they grabbed, then swallow it whole as you see it slide down their neck.
Next up, the King of the Coast, in my humble estimation, the osprey. One of the most widespread raptors in the world, known globally. They migrate thousands of miles between southern wintering regions and northern breeding grounds.
The ultimate coastal bird of prey. You can watch YouTube videos of an osprey literally underwater, using its wings most uniquely, like a waterborne helicopter, rising to the surface with a fish half its own mass, and then eventually becoming airborne, and as it flies, it manipulates the fish with its talons until the fish is oriented headfirst into the wind to reduce drag. It’s an amazing thing to witness. In flight, they are distinctively shaped, holding their wings in a bowed M-shape. And they have a reversible outer toe allow them to grip with two facing forward and two backward. Barbed pads on their feet make sure slippery fish aren’t lost.
And of the aforementioned ducks, I’ve seen an osprey swoop in on ducklet number three, apparently when there’s no fish. It was harsh and ugly, but natural.
The stare of the osprey is unique amongst birds of prey in that its eyesight is 19x better than the human eye. They have a transparent nictitating membrane (basically a third eyelid) that protects their eyes from the impact of diving into the water.


And to wrap it up, a few Honorable Mentions:

-Black skimmers. On a calm piece of water, they swoop in low, open their elongated “candycorn” mandible and literally skim the surface to scoop up small fish. If it’s quiet enough, you can hear the sound of their bill slicing through the water. Uncanny evolution.

-Cormorants. These duck-like birds feed by diving and swimming beneath the water, using their webbed feet to propel themselves to find small fish. The most notable trait of this bird is that you’ll often see them in the distinct posture of holding out their wings to dry. This is because their feathers are not as waterproof as those of other water birds, making them less buoyant, which makes it easier for them to move about underwater.

-And lastly, Kingfishers, if for no other reason than having such a solid name! They also possess vibrant blue, green and/or orange plumage (depending upon the particular species) and are experts at hovering then diving headfirst to catch fish. The kingfisher’s unique beak shape, which slices through the water without creating a splash, inspired the nose cones of Japan’s high-speed “bullet trains” to eliminate sonic booms in tunnels.
